About John D. Sherman
John D. Sherman is a scholar working on Nephrology, Industrial and Manufacturing Engineering, Pulmonary and Respiratory Medicine, Catalysis and Biomedical Engineering, having authored 4 papers that have together received 227 indexed citations. Recurring topics across this work include Parathyroid Disorders and Treatments (1 paper), Catalysis and Oxidation Reactions (1 paper), Potassium and Related Disorders (1 paper), Chemical Synthesis and Characterization (1 paper), Membrane-based Ion Separation Techniques (1 paper), Zeolite Catalysis and Synthesis (1 paper) and Mesoporous Materials and Catalysis (1 paper). The work is most often cited by research in Inorganic Chemistry (143 citations), Industrial and Manufacturing Engineering (41 citations), Catalysis (21 citations), Materials Chemistry (98 citations) and Biomaterials (20 citations). John D. Sherman has collaborated with scholars based in United States and Canada. Frequent co-authors include D. W. Breck, Richard Braun, R. Anderson, Richard R. Willis, Stephen R. Ash and Theodore Vermeulen. Their work appears in journals such as ASAIO Journal and Proceedings of the National Academy of Sciences.
